19 Grosvenor Road, Stockport, SK4 4EE is a freehold terraced property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 1,249 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£403,249 , which equates to approximately £323 per square foot. It was last sold on 20 May 2003 for £142,000. Since then, the value has increased by £261,249, representing a 184.0% increase, or approximately 8.1% per year.

The current estimated value of £403,249 is:

  • 23.4% lower than the average property price on Grosvenor Road
  • 26.1% lower than the average in the SK4 4EE postcode area
  • and 33.2% higher than the average price for Stockport as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 17 January 2022, the property was recorded as rented.

EPC Summary

19 Grosvenor Road, Stockport, Greater Manchester, SK4 4EE has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 17 Jan 2022.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from the main heating system, though the cylinder has no thermostat.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 22 Feb 2011, when the property was rated D. The current rating of E re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 8.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from average to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, standard tariff to from main system, no cylinder thermostat, with its energy efficiency improving from very poor to average.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, limited ins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from average to very poor.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, partial ins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from average to poor.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 55%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 30% of fixed outlets, with efficiency changing from good to average.
